BISEXUALS: NAVIGATING MONOGAMY AND NONMONOGAMY IN RELATIONSHIPS

2 min read Bisexual

Bisexuals may have conflicting feelings about their sexual and romantic desires. Some prefer to be in monogamous relationships while others seek out multiple partners. This discrepancy can create difficulties for some bisexuals who want both types of relationships simultaneously. Bisexuals experience pressure from society to conform to either monogamy or polyamory.

There are ways to reconcile these desires despite cultural expectations.

Bisexual individuals should identify what kind of relationship they desire. It is important to explore one's needs, wants, and values before entering into any type of relationship. If someone prefers monogamy but feels drawn to non-monogamy due to societal pressures, it could lead to confusion and frustration. By acknowledging this dilemma, bisexuals can begin exploring different solutions that work best for them.

Communication is key when navigating between monogamy and non-monogamy within a relationship. Bisexual couples need to talk openly about boundaries regarding intimacy outside of the primary relationship. They can discuss whether they feel comfortable with flirting, sexually experimenting with other people, and even having physical contact without sex. These talks allow each partner to express their thoughts and feelings honestly without fear of judgment or punishment.
